This link was helpful:
http://forums.rennlist.com/rennforums/944-turbo-and-turbo-s-forum/603073-o2-sensor-voltage-range-to-afrs.html
Pretty much says “2.5 x Volt + 10 = AFR” based on a 0v – 4v O2 sensor. Is this what our O2 sensor has for voltage?
If ours is a 0v - 1v system (narrowband) then the equation would be "10 x Volt + 10 = AFR"
I am pretty sure ours in a narrow band. Which only measure cruising AFR 13 to like 17 not good for checking at WOT under 12
